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Čo je Cron v Linuxe ?

Cron , a súvisiace crontab , sú integrované funkcie v operačnom systéme Linux , môžete použiť , aby opakujúce sa alebo nudné úlohy jednoduchšie . To môže trvať nejakú prax použiť cron úspešne , ale odmeny , aby sa to oplatilo . Mnoho užívateľov Linuxu použiť cron tráviť menej času udržiavanie svojich strojov a viac času baví ich . Čo Cron je

Cron je program , ktorý môže spustiť ďalšie programy v danom čase . Tento proces sa nazýva crontab programu , ktorý je súčasťou väčšiny linuxových distribúcií . Nie všetci používatelia môžu použiť cron . K dispozícii sú dva súbory , ktoré určujú , kto môže používať cron a kto nie . Tieto súbory sú umiestnené v " /usr /lib /cron /cron.allow " a " /usr /lib /cron /cron.deny " adresárov , resp . Aby bolo možné používať cron alebo crontab , vaše užívateľské meno musí byť umiestnený v priečinku " Povoliť " , a to nemôže byť uvedený v zložke " popierajú " .
Ako Cron je použitý

môžete použiť cron prípravou textový súbor s predvoleným textovom editore . Tento textový súbor musí byť v určitom formáte , a musí uviesť program alebo programy , ktoré chcete spustiť , rovnako ako v čase , kedy by mal začať . Akonáhle máte textový súbor , môžete ju zavolať pomocou programu crontab . Ak to chcete vykonať , zadajte " crontab - e , " bez úvodzoviek . Pri zadaní tohto príkazu do príkazového riadku , bude crontab vytvoriť prázdny cron dokument pre vás .
Správna Cron Formát

Je veľmi dôležité , aby ste učiť sa a realizovať správnu syntax cron . V podstate existuje šesť komponentov do súboru cron . Jedná sa o " min " , " hodiny " , " deň v mesiaci " , " mesiac " , " deň v týždni " a " program , ktorý chcete spustiť . " Každá hodnota je napísaný horizontálne bez úvodzoviek , a s jedným priestorom medzi nimi . Nie je nutné zapísať hodnotu pre každé pole , ale ak necháte pole prázdne , musíte zadať " * " , znak na svojom mieste . Nakoniec , keď zadáte " program , ktorý chcete spustiť " hodnotu , musíte uviesť úplnú cestu k programu .
Cron Príklad

plný napríklad budete chcieť použitie je " 15 20 *** rm /home /user /tmp /* " . Všimnite si , nahradí " užívateľa " s vlastným užívateľským menom . Dalo by sa použiť tento príkaz na odstránenie dočasných súborov každý deň v 20:15 Tento príklad ukazuje , ako môžete použiť cron zjednodušiť a automatizovať nudné úlohy , ktoré musia byť vykonané ručne na mnohých iných operačných systémoch . Keď nastavíte súbor pracovnej cron a úlohy v nej sú vykonávané , bude crontab automaticky odoslať e - mail na e - mailové konto spojený s vaším užívateľským účtom Linux . Ak chcete toto správanie zakázať , stačí pridať " > /dev /null 2 > & 1 " bez úvodzoviek , aby na konci svojho cron súboru .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ené